The deflection refractometer, which actions the deflection of a beam of monochromatic gentle by a double prism wherein the reference and sample cells are separated by a diagonal glass divide. When both equally cells comprise solvent of exactly the same composition, no deflection of The sunshine beam takes place; if, nevertheless, the composition in the column cellular period is adjusted as a result of existence of the solute, more info then the altered refractive index brings about the beam to generally be deflected.
